Output 52727595e78e2b690a9bfb28be55e0a922f868d5e2a9ccdb426f53cfd283d860:4

value
999960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1909f67ea63a1c38b92225b2361b84ebbd80af0a OP_EQUAL
address
33yQka7z8oStv2xHaaCynSUBXk1AfNoBpY
transaction
52727595e78e2b690a9bfb28be55e0a922f868d5e2a9ccdb426f53cfd283d860
spent
true